在Debian环境下安装和管理Oracle软件包可以通过多种方法实现,以下是一些基本的步骤和指南:
安装必要的依赖包:
在开始安装Oracle之前,确保你已经安装了以下依赖包:
sudo apt-get update
sudo apt-get install make gcc glibc6-dev binutils libc6 libc6-dev libstdc6 libstdc5 libaio1 linux-headers elfutils libaio-dev sysstat unixodbc-bin unixodbc-dev pdksh
创建用户和组:
创建用于Oracle安装的用户和组:
sudo groupadd dba
sudo groupadd oinstall
sudo useradd -g oinstall -G dba -m oracle
sudo passwd oracle
创建安装目录:
创建Oracle的安装目录,并设置相应的权限:
sudo mkdir -p /usr/local/ora10/product/10.1.0
sudo mkdir /var/opt/oracle
sudo chown -R oracle:oinstall /var/opt/oracle
sudo chmod -R 775 /var/opt/oracle
设置内核参数:
修改/etc/sysctl.conf
和/etc/security/limits.conf
文件,以适应Oracle的安装需求。
下载并解压Oracle安装文件:
从Oracle官方网站下载适用于Debian的Oracle安装文件,然后解压到指定目录。
运行安装脚本:
使用以下命令运行安装脚本:
./datadisk/oracle11g/database/runInstaller
根据安装向导的提示完成安装过程。
设置环境变量:
编辑/etc/profile
文件,添加以下内容:
export ORACLE_BASE=/usr/local/ora10
export ORACLE_HOME=$ORACLE_BASE/product/10.1.0
export PATH=$ORACLE_HOME/bin:$PATH
export LD_LIBRARY_PATH=$ORACLE_HOME/lib:/usr/local/lib:$LD_LIBRARY_PATH
export TNS_ADMIN=$ORACLE_HOME
然后执行source /etc/profile
使配置生效。
创建监听器和数据库:
使用netca
和dbca
工具创建监听器和数据库。
连接到Oracle数据库:
使用sqlplus
工具连接到数据库,验证安装是否成功:
sqlplus / as sysdba
输入密码后,如果成功登录到SQL*Plus提示符,表示安装成功。
请注意,以上步骤是基于特定版本的Oracle和Debian系统,具体步骤可能会有所不同。建议参考Oracle官方文档或相关社区指南以获取适用于你特定版本的详细安装指南。